在花了很长时间使 SSL 在 Windows 上的 Qt 上工作之后,大多数 HTTPS 网站似乎都在工作。现在在需要时添加了不受信任的证书等,一切都很好……但由于某些奇怪的原因,我无法登录 reuters.com。
拿一个 QWebView,添加一些魔法来处理出现的 ssl 错误,继续访问 reuters 然后单击登录。然后发生了一些奇怪的事情。首先,它要求接受不受信任的证书,这并不奇怪。但是,一旦完成,什么也不会发生。QWebView 等待并且永远不会发送 loadFinished(bool) 信号。更多显示的网页不会改变。
当我尝试在 Firefox 或 IE 上执行此操作时,它告诉我网页上有混合内容。会不会是问题?